Coy Wright, age 85, of Amity, died Wednesday, February 19, 2003.

He was born on September 7, 1917 at Lucky, Arkansas, the son of James Edmond Wright and Rena Cleola Newcomb Wright. On February 8, 1941, he was married to Velma Triplett. He was preceded in death by his parents; his son, Coy Robert Wright; his brother, Edgar Andrew Wright; and his sister, Josephine Evanelle Story.

Coy was a U. S. Army field artillery division veteran of World War II. After the service, he worked in several jobs in many states before becoming a farmer and an accomplished carpenter. He was a member of the Shiloh Church of Christ and was active in church work for all of his life. He had an outstanding singing voice and loved singing in church services and gospel singings.

He is survived by his wife, Velma Triplett Wright of Amity; his daughter, Teresa Newborn of Tuscaloosa, Alabama; five sisters and their spouses, Estelle and John Dillard of Newkirk, Oklahoma, Arlene Nunes of Gridley, California, Winifred and John Egleston of Mount Ida, Ruth and Brack Stanley of Roseburg, Oregon, and Brooks and Ray Carpenter of North Ridgeville, Ohio; one sister-in-law, Clara Wright of Oklahoma City, Oklahoma; one brother-in-law, Clarence O. Story of Grants Pass, Oregon; three grandchildren and their spouses, Tammy and Robert Rogers of Amity, Dale and Kristina Wright of Amity, and Robin Newborn of Tuscaloosa, Alabama; and four great-grandchildren, Megan Rogers, Sean Rogers, Kimberly Wright and, Andrea Wright.

Services will be held at 2:00 PM, Friday, February 21, 2003 in the Shiloh Church of Christ with Rick Collie and Luke Henson officiating.

Visitation will be Thursday, 5:00 PM until 7:00 PM.

Interment will be in the Sweet Home Cemetery with military services under the direction of the Veterans of Foreign Wars, Post 2278, of Hot Springs.

Arrangements are under the direction of Davis-Smith Funeral Home, Glenwood.

Since we never knew our grandparents on the “Wright” side, I looked upon Uncle Coy as the patriarch for the family. A visit to their house included the chicken hatchery with Aunt Velma hard at work in “that cold room” and Uncle Coy walking the hen house or taking us for a ride in the cow pasture in his truck, with the pistol on the dash for snakes. They often welcomed us to their home and also their camper where “roughing it” meant a bed as nice as home, and a breakfast better than at home. I assume we never expressed our thankfulness – just another task that can be accomplished when we join Uncle Coy on Heaven’s bright shore.

I will always remember our annual vacations to AR and my opportunity to spend a couple of days with Uncle Coy and Aunt Velma. Uncle Coy would always take me on these long "guided tours" through the backwoods and show me where some relative once lived or was born. It was the same route every year and I always loved it!
